Can you wear jeans to a steakhouse? Yes, you can wear jeans to many steakhouses, especially those with a casual or business-casual dress code. However, the appropriateness of jeans depends on the specific steakhouse and its atmosphere. It’s always a good idea to check the restaurant’s dress code in advance.
What to Consider When Wearing Jeans to a Steakhouse
Understanding Dress Codes
Steakhouses vary widely in terms of formality, from upscale establishments to more relaxed venues. Here are some common dress codes:
- Casual: Jeans are typically acceptable, paired with a neat top.
- Business Casual: Opt for darker, well-fitted jeans with a button-down shirt or a blouse.
- Formal: Jeans might not be appropriate. Instead, consider slacks or a dress.
Choosing the Right Jeans
When deciding to wear jeans to a steakhouse, consider the following tips to ensure they are suitable:
- Fit: Choose well-fitted jeans that are neither too tight nor too loose.
- Color: Darker jeans often appear more polished and are more versatile for dressier occasions.
- Condition: Avoid jeans with rips, tears, or excessive fading.
Pairing Jeans with the Right Attire
To elevate your look when wearing jeans to a steakhouse, consider these outfit ideas:
- For Men: Pair jeans with a crisp button-down shirt, a blazer, and polished shoes.
- For Women: Combine jeans with a stylish blouse, a statement necklace, and heeled boots or elegant flats.
Examples of Steakhouse Dress Codes
Here’s a comparison of dress codes at different types of steakhouses:
| Steakhouse Type | Dress Code | Jeans Allowed? | Suggested Attire |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casual Steakhouse | Casual | Yes | Jeans, T-shirt, casual shoes |
| Chain Steakhouse | Business Casual | Often | Dark jeans, collared shirt, loafers |
| Fine Dining | Formal | No | Suit or cocktail dress |
Why Dress Codes Matter
Dress codes help maintain the ambiance and experience that a steakhouse aims to offer. For instance, an upscale steakhouse might enforce a formal dress code to preserve its luxurious atmosphere. Conversely, a casual steakhouse may encourage a relaxed vibe, making jeans entirely appropriate.

What should I wear to a steakhouse if jeans aren’t allowed?
If jeans aren’t allowed, opt for slacks or khakis paired with a dress shirt for men, or a skirt or dress pants with a blouse for women. Adding a blazer or a stylish jacket can enhance the look.
Are ripped jeans acceptable at steakhouses?
Ripped jeans are generally not recommended at steakhouses, especially at those with a business casual or formal dress code. Opt for clean, undamaged jeans to ensure a more polished appearance.
How can I check a steakhouse’s dress code?
To check a steakhouse’s dress code, visit their website or call ahead. Many restaurants list their dress code online under the "About" or "FAQ" sections. Speaking with a staff member can also provide clarity.
Can I wear sneakers with jeans to a steakhouse?
Sneakers can be appropriate at casual steakhouses, but for business casual settings, consider more polished footwear like loafers or dress shoes. Sneakers can detract from the overall sophistication of the outfit.
What other attire is suitable for a steakhouse?
Aside from jeans, other suitable attire includes chinos, dress pants, or a skirt. Pair these with a neat shirt or blouse, and consider adding accessories like a watch or jewelry to complete the look.
